Here's an interview with chef David Chang by HuffPo full of generic questions like "What is your favourite cheap food thrill?" and "What would you be doing if you couldn't be a chef?" On the "wildest thing" he's ever done in a kitchen, Chang talks about cooking at NASA's Space Food Systems Laboratory in Houston, TX: "[M]y recipe was a total failure. Sorry I didn't know how to fucking cook in zero gravity. I tried, I didn't know what they had stocked on the station either." [HuffPo]
